Literature summary for 1.14.19.17 extracted from

  • Michel, C.; Van Echten-Deckert, G.; Rother, J.; Sandhoff, K.; Wang, E.; Merrill Jr., A.
    Characterization of ceramide synthesis. A dihydroceramide desaturase introduces the 4,5-trans-double bond of sphingosine at the level of dihydroceramide (1997), J. Biol. Chem., 272, 22432-22437.

Storage Stability

Storage Stability Organism
-4°C, phosphate buffer (100 mM NaH2PO4/Na2HPO4, pH 7.4), 7 days, approximately 50% of the activity is lost Rattus norvegicus
-80°C, phosphate buffer (100 mM NaH2PO4/Na2HPO4, pH 7.4), 1 year, approximately 50% of the activity is lost Rattus norvegicus
37°C, phosphate buffer (100 mM NaH2PO4/Na2HPO4, pH 7.4), 3 h, approximately 50% of the activity is lost Rattus norvegicus
